South Llano River State Park

South Llano River State Park is a Hill Country paradise along the crystal-clear South Llano River. Known for its wild turkey roosts (one of the largest in Texas), excellent river swimming, and scenic hiking, it offers a quintessential Texas Hill Country camping experience. The river is spring-fed and perfect for tubing, swimming, and fishing.

67 campsites|Hill Country|2 hr 30 min from Austin|$5/person entrance fee

Campsite Types

Water + Electric

$20/night*

56 sites

Water, 30-amp electric; restrooms with showers nearbyRV OKTent OK

Walk-in Tent

$15/night*

6 sites

Water nearby, chemical toilets; restrooms with showers nearby; 30-70 yard walk-inTent OK

Primitive Hike-in

$10/night*

5 sites

No water - pack in; composting toilet in area; at least 1.5 miles from trailheadTent OK

Guide to South Llano River State Park

Best Campsites

For Families:Book the standard sites with water and electricity — they have nearby restrooms with showers and are the most family-friendly option
For Privacy:The primitive hike-in sites (at least 1.5 miles from the trailhead) offer the most solitude, with the walk-in sites a closer second
For RVs:The water-and-electric sites are the only RV-friendly option; they go fastest, so book early

When to Go

March through November. Summer weekends are hot but the river keeps you cool. Spring and fall are ideal.

Tips

  • Bring a tube and float the river — it is clear, cool, and beautiful
  • Watch the wild turkey roost at dusk from the observation blind (fall-winter)
  • Golden-cheeked warblers nest here in spring — bring binoculars
  • The walk-in tent sites along the river are some of the best in the Hill Country

Highlights

Crystal-clear spring-fed South Llano RiverWild turkey roosting site (one of Texas's largest)River swimming and tubing18 miles of hiking and biking trailsExcellent birding (golden-cheeked warblers)Dark sky stargazing

What is the entrance fee at South Llano River State Park?+

The entrance fee at South Llano River State Park is $5 per person per day. A Texas State Parks Pass ($70/year) waives entrance fees for you and all passengers in your vehicle.
